George Orwell, a renowned journalist and novelist, is celebrated for his influential works, especially 'Nineteen Eighty-Four.' In this conversation, Orwell's ethical insights emerge, rooted in a rich philosophical dialogue. He discusses the balance of well-being versus essential human needs, advocating for deeper psychological fulfillment. The connection between Orwell and Thoreau emphasizes the value of dignity and decency in society, while also tackling the moral implications of individual worth against the backdrop of totalitarianism.
